From ce4920314bb7306ea1c801fbbdeb2396c5fcccfe Mon Sep 17 00:00:00 2001 From: Your Name Date: Sat, 26 Apr 2025 22:38:32 +1200 Subject: [PATCH] . --- src/main_commands.cpp | 27 +++++++++++++++++---------- 1 file changed, 17 insertions(+), 10 deletions(-) diff --git a/src/main_commands.cpp b/src/main_commands.cpp index 6133e2e..8ddabc9 100644 --- a/src/main_commands.cpp +++ b/src/main_commands.cpp @@ -113,19 +113,26 @@ int restore(const std::vector &args) // run the restore script std::cout << "OK, here goes..." << std::endl; - std::cout << "1) Backing up existing service... " << std::flush; - std::vector backup_args = {"dropshell","backup",server_name, service_name}; - if (!backup(backup_args,true)) // silent=true - { - std::cerr << std::endl; - std::cerr << "Error: Backup failed, restore aborted." << std::endl; - return 1; + { // backup existing service + std::cout << "1) Backing up existing service... " << std::flush; + std::vector backup_args = {"dropshell","backup",server_name, service_name}; + if (!backup(backup_args,true)) // silent=true + { + std::cerr << std::endl; + std::cerr << "Error: Backup failed, restore aborted." << std::endl; + return 1; + } + std::cout << "Backup complete." << std::endl; } - std::cout << "Backup complete." << std::endl; - std::cout << "2) Restoring service from backup..." << std::endl; - + { // restore service from backup + std::cout << "2) Restoring service from backup..." << std::endl; + } + + { // initialise service + std::cout << "3) Initialising service..." << std::endl; + } // run the restore script return 0;